Today on The Sword & The Trowel podcast, Tom Ascol and Graham Gunden continue in their series of walking through the 1689 Second London Baptist Confession of Faith. The continue their discussion through Chapter 2 on God and the Holy Trinity, specifically focusing on God, His attributes, and the Trinity.
